Public school enrollment holds steady, once again

No matter how much Oconee County grows, you can count on one thing. The enrollment of the public schools will always come between 10 and 11 thousand students. That’s the case, so far, this year as the numbers from the county school district for the first 15 days of the new year came in at 10, 628. Of the three high schools, Walhalla counts the most students at 1,140. Walhalla Middle sports the highest enrollment of the middle schools at 877. Seneca’s Northside Elementary topped all elementary school enrollments with 684 students.
